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
860069 79194777880 271522935 136166 482869
716250 0261432946 021813617
716250 0261432946 021813617
55684132004 098678 4384646492
All about undefined
Interested in learning more?
716250 0261432946 021813617
55684132004 098678 4384646492
See more
18 8122799292
781 3140568325 671 106425
See more
5321405207 4145705959
1464800321 9421285424 2054
See more